Lofexidine
go.drugbank.com/drugs/DB04948ApprovedInvestigationalLofexidine is a non-opioid centrally acting alpha2-adrenergic receptor agonist that was first approved for the treatment of opioid withdrawal in the United Kingdom in 1992.

Cobicistat
go.drugbank.com/drugs/DB09065ApprovedInvestigationalAlthough it does not have any anti-HIV activity, cobicistat acts as a pharmacokinetic enhancer by inhibiting cytochrome P450 3A isoforms (CYP3A) and therefore increases the systemic exposure of coadministered … Increasing systemic exposure of anti-retrovirals (ARVs) without increasing dosage allows for better treatment outcomes and a decreased side effect profile.
